WebRedis Graph is a low-latency graph database based on the property graph model built as a Redis module. Like all graphs, a property graph has nodes and relationships. However, it adds extra expressiveness by providing: Nodes: Graph data entities Relationships: Connect nodes (has direction and a type) WebIt’s 100% free pure desktop Redis GUI that provides easy-to-use browser tools to query, visualize and interactively manipulate graphs. Web15. jún 2024 · 4. To delete duplicates you can use the following. MATCH (p:Person) WITH p.id as id, collect (p) AS nodes WHERE size (nodes) > 1 UNWIND nodes [1..] AS node DELETE node. Share.
